One full week of NFL preseason action is in the books, and there’s plenty to talk about.
After a promising NFL debut in the Browns’ preseason opener, Shedeur Sanders entered the week with even more attention than before. On Wednesday, he didn’t take part in either 7-on-7 or 11-on-11 drills in Browns-Eagles joint practice.

The reason, per the team, was straightforward: Sanders suffered an oblique injury early Wednesday and was held out.

The QB rotation went like this in his stead:
7-on-7: veteran Kenny Pickett with the first team; third-round rookie Dillon Gabriel with the second team; and recently signed veteran Tyler Huntley with the third team
11-on-11: presumptive QB1 Joe Flacco with the 1s; Gabriel with one play with the 1s and the rest with the 2s; and then Huntley with the 2s
Red zone 11-on-11: Flacco with the 1s, Gabriel with the 2s
So there you have it. Still no word who will start Saturday’s second preseason game at the Eagles, or whether Sanders will even play.

Jerry Jones reveals he battled stage 4 melanoma: Cowboys team owner Jerry Jones told the Dallas Morning News that he beat stage 4 melanoma after over a decade including four surgeries. “I now have no tumors,” Jones, who is 82 years old, said. His initial diagnosis came in 2010, and over the next 10 years he had two surgeries on his lungs and two on his lymph nodes. He credited the experimental drug PD-1 — short for Programmed Cell Death Protein 1 — for his recovery. “I was saved by a fabulous treatment and great doctors and a real miracle [drug] called PD-1 [therapy],” Jones said, via the Morning News. “I went into trials for that PD-1 and it has been one of the great medicines.”
No Browns starting QB named for Eagles game yet: We know this much: Joe Flacco is the presumptive starter at quarterback when the regular season starts, and he won’t play on Saturday. Neither will veteran Kenny Pickett, long assumed to be QB2. That’s about it, as there are no decisions whether Shedeur Sanders or Dillon Gabriel will start Saturday in the Browns’ second preseason game at the Eagles. What’s more: Sanders didn’t get QB3 reps in 7-on-7 drills vs. the Eagles Wednesday —–— veteran camp arm Tyler Huntley did. We’ll see what head coach Kevin Stefanski says after practice.
Najee Harris returns to practice after fireworks injury: Chargers running back Najee Harris was seen running drills with a football on Tuesday for the first time in training camp, according to ESPN’s Kris Rhim. He reportedly did so off to the side with a trainer. It has been more than a month since Harris sustained what was described as a “superficial” eye injury during a Fourth of July fireworks mishap. His agent insisted he would be ready for the start of the regular season, but the Chargers have so far been hesitant to provide anything resembling a timetable for his return.
